Method 1. Update your Graphics Driver

The first method that you can try to fix the issue of the Full Screen Not Working or being Broken in Diablo IV is to update the graphics driver. One of the reasons you are facing this issue is that your graphics driver is not up to date. If you have not updated your graphics driver, then it is the time to do it. You can update your Graphics driver with the help of the steps given below.

  • Step 1. First of all, you will have to go to the search bar on the desktop.
  • Step 2. Then, you will have to search for the Device Manager.
  • Step 3. Now, open the Device Manager from the search results. You can also open the Device Manager by pressing the Windows key + X. After that, select the Device Manager option.
  • Step 4. After that, find for the display adapters. And then, double click on it.
  • Step 5. Now, you will have to right click on the driver that you are currently using.
  • Step 6. As you will click on it, a list of options will appear. You will have to select the Update Driver option.
  • Step 7. After that, you will have to select the Search automatically for drivers option.
  • Step 8. Now, if any update is available, then it will automatically start downloading it.
  • Step 9. Once the update is finished, restart your PC.

After doing this, check whether your issue is fixed or not. If still you are facing the issue, then try using the next method.

Method 2. Run the game as an Administrator

The second method that you can try to fix the issue of the Full Screen Not Working or being Broken in Diablo IV is to run the game as an administrator. We will suggest you to run the game’s exe file as an administrator to prevent complications with user account control related privileges. It will be good if the battle.net client will run on your computer as an administrator as well. To run the Diablo IV as an administrator, you will have to follow the steps given below.

  • Step 1. First of all, you will have to go to the location where the shortcut file of Diablo IV exe is saved.
  • Step 2. Now, you will have to right click on the file.
  • Step 3. Then, a list of options will appear. You will have to click on the Properties option.
  • Step 4. After that, you will have to go to the compatibility tab.
  • Step 5. Now, you will see an option of Run this program as an administrator. You will have to click on it to tick mark the check box of it.
  • Step 6. Lastly, click on Ok and Apply to save the changes.

After doing these steps, check whether your issue is fixed or not. If still you are facing the issue, then we will suggest you to try using the next method.

 Method 3. Update the Diablo IV game

Now, the next method that you can try to fix the issue of the Full Screen Not Working or being Broken in Diablo IV is to update the game. One of the reasons you are facing this issue is that the game is not updated. We will suggest you to check whether any update is available or not. If available, then download it immediately. To update the Diablo IV, you will have to follow the steps given below.

  • Step 1. First of all, you will have to open the Battle. net.
  • Step 2. Now, on the top left corner, you will see a Blizzard logo. You will have to click on that.
  • Step 3. After that, you will have to go to the Settings option.
  • Step 4. Then, click on the Game Install/ Update option.
  • Step 5. Now, you will have to scroll down and then you will see an option of Apply the latest updates and download future patch data for recently played games.
  • Step 6. You will have to click on that option to enable it.
  • Step 7. Now, click on the Done option to save the changes.
  • Step 8. Finally, restart the Battle.net launcher.

After doing these steps, it should automatically start updating to the new version if any is found. Once done, then check whether your issue is fixed or not. If still, you are facing the issue, then try using the next method.

Method 4. Disable the Overlays Applications

Now, the next method that you can try to fix the issue of the Full Screen Not Working or being Broken in Diablo IV is to disable the Overlays Applications. Some overlay applications have been known to cause Blizzard games to cause issues such as full screen broken. Several applications have overlays, which allow information to be shown on top of another program. The ability to see who is speaking when playing games is enabled by default in many voice applications.

To fix the issue, we will suggest you to try disabling the overlays application. Airfoil, Dxtory, MSI Afterburner, RadeonPro, XFire, Discord, and many more are a few examples of overlay apps that might be problematic. Once disabled, check whether your issue is fixed or not. If still you are facing the error, then try using the next method.

Method 5. Run the game in Compatibility mode

Now, the another method that you can try to fix the issue of the Full Screen Not Working or being Broken in Diablo IV is to run the game in Compatibility mode. Many users have tried this method and they were successful in fixing them. So, we will suggest you try this method once and check whether the issue is fixed or not. To run the game in compatibility mode, you will have to follow the steps given below.

  • Step 1. First of all, you will have to go to the location where the shortcut file of Diablo IV exe is saved.
  • Step 2. Now, you will have to right click on the file.
  • Step 3. Then, a list of options will appear. You will have to click on the Properties option.
  • Step 4. After that, you will have to go to the compatibility tab.
  • Step 5. Now, you will see an option of Run this program in compatibility mode. You will have to click on it to tick mark its check box.
  • Step 6. After that, you will have to choose the version of Windows that the game was designed for.
  • Step 7. Last;y, click on ok and Apply to save the changes.

Once you have done these steps, try using the game and check whether your issue is solved or not. If still the issue is not solved, then try using the next method.

Method 7. Check your Screen Resolution and the Scaling Settings

The another method that you can try to fix the issue of the Full Screen Not Working or being Broken in Diablo IV is to Check your Screen Resolution and the Scaling Settings. The full-screen broken fault in Diablo IV can occasionally be brought on by insufficient scaling and resolution options. So, we will suggest you to verify that the scaling and screen resolution is set to the monitor’s recommended values. You can check the Screen Resolution and the Scaling Settings by using the steps given below.

  • Step 1. First of all, you will have to right click on the desktop.
  • Step 2. Now, you will see a list of options. Click on the Display Settings option.
  • Step 3. After that, verify that scaling is set to 100% and that your resolution is at the suggested level. If not, then do it.

Once done, then check whether your issue is fixed or not. If not fixed, then try using the next method.
